libexpr: remove matchAttrs boolean from ExprLambda
The boolean is only used to determine if the formals are set to a non-null pointer in all our cases. We can get rid of that allocation and instead just compare the pointer value with NULL. Saving up to sizeof(bool) + platform specific alignment per ExprLambda instace. Probably not a lot of memory but perhaps a few kilobyte with nixpkgs? This also gets rid of a potential issue with dereferencing formals based on the value of the boolean that didn't have to be aligned with the formals pointer but was in all our cases.
